绵羊肺压力-容积特性的指数分析

Exponential analysis of the pressure-volume characteristics of ovine lungs.

作者信息

Collie D D, Watt N J, Warren P M, Begara I, Luján L

机构信息

Royal (Dick) School of Veterinary Studies, Veterinary Field Station, Roslin, Midlothian, UK.

出版信息

Respir Physiol. 1994 Mar;95(3):239-47. doi: 10.1016/0034-5687(94)90087-6.

DOI:10.1016/0034-5687(94)90087-6
PMID:8059069
Abstract

Static pressure-volume curves were generated from data obtained from 18 normal anaesthetized adult sheep. Lung volumes were determined by helium dilution. An exponential curve of the form V = Vmax - Ae-KP was fitted to the pressure-volume data from each sheep where P is the static recoil pressure, Vmax represents the volume asymptote, A is the difference between Vmax and the intercept on the volume axis and K defines the slope and hence the shape of the P-V curve. Quality of fit of the data was assessed visually, by means of a sign test and a runs test and by the coefficient of determination (r2). Exponential equations were found to adequately describe the shape of the pressure-volume curve in sheep. The exponent K was not correlated with effective alveolar volume (VAeff) (rs = 0.183; P > 0.05). Static lung compliance was determined over a volume range from the end-expiratory level (VEEL) to VEEL plus 400 ml. Measurements of static lung compliance were significantly correlated with measurements of effective alveolar volume (VAeff) (rs = 0.505; P < 0.025). In the ovine, the exponent K, an index of distensibility, is independent of lung volume and offers a means of assessing lung distensibility in this species.

摘要

静态压力-容积曲线由18只正常麻醉成年绵羊的数据生成。肺容积通过氦稀释法测定。将V = Vmax - Ae-KP形式的指数曲线拟合到每只绵羊的压力-容积数据,其中P为静态回缩压力,Vmax代表容积渐近线,A是Vmax与容积轴截距之间的差值,K定义斜率,从而确定P-V曲线的形状。通过目视评估、符号检验、游程检验以及决定系数(r2)来评估数据的拟合质量。发现指数方程能够充分描述绵羊压力-容积曲线的形状。指数K与有效肺泡容积(VAeff)不相关(rs = 0.183;P > 0.05)。在从呼气末水平(VEEL)到VEEL加400毫升的容积范围内测定静态肺顺应性。静态肺顺应性测量值与有效肺泡容积(VAeff)测量值显著相关(rs = 0.505;P < 0.025)。在绵羊中,指数K作为扩张性指标,与肺容积无关,为评估该物种的肺扩张性提供了一种方法。
